test(cli): RED — reproduce re-runs members under the default stop regime
A member minted under a non-default vol-stop (manifest stamps
stop_length/stop_k) spuriously reports DIVERGED on reproduce: both the
param-space probe and the member re-run hardcode StopRule::Vol{3,2.0}.
Closed blueprint isolates the stop as the only differing dimension.
refs #233
